news 2026/4/29 19:51:21

PowerShell ImportExcel模块:无需Excel的终极数据处理解决方案

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
PowerShell ImportExcel模块:无需Excel的终极数据处理解决方案

PowerShell ImportExcel模块:无需Excel的终极数据处理解决方案

【免费下载链接】ImportExcelPowerShell module to import/export Excel spreadsheets, without Excel项目地址: https://gitcode.com/gh_mirrors/im/ImportExcel

还在为处理Excel数据而烦恼吗?PowerShell ImportExcel模块为您提供了一套完整的数据处理方案,让您无需安装Microsoft Excel软件即可轻松完成Excel文件的导入、导出、图表生成和数据分析等复杂操作。这个强大的开源工具彻底改变了数据处理的方式,为系统管理员、数据分析师和开发人员带来了革命性的工作效率提升。

为什么选择ImportExcel模块?三大核心优势

ImportExcel模块的最大优势在于完全摆脱了对Excel COM组件的依赖。这意味着您可以在服务器环境、自动化脚本中自由使用,无需担心软件许可问题或性能瓶颈。无论您需要处理CSV文件、JSON数据,还是创建专业的商业报表,ImportExcel都能完美胜任!

跨平台兼容性:ImportExcel模块支持Windows、Linux和macOS三大操作系统,真正实现了跨平台的数据处理能力。

零依赖环境:无需安装Microsoft Office或Excel,直接在PowerShell环境中运行,大大简化了部署和维护成本。

功能全面强大:从简单的数据导入导出到复杂的数据透视表、图表生成,ImportExcel提供了完整的Excel功能替代方案。

ImportExcel模块的核心功能详解

强大的数据透视表功能

ImportExcel模块最令人印象深刻的功能之一就是数据透视表的生成能力。通过简单的PowerShell命令,您可以快速创建复杂的数据汇总和分析报表。

多数据透视表分析示例

如图所示,ImportExcel可以同时生成多个数据透视表,并自动创建对应的可视化图表。左侧显示内存使用情况分析,右侧展示句柄数量统计,为企业资源监控提供了完美的解决方案。这种多维度数据分析能力让您能够从不同角度深入理解数据。

自动化批量数据导出

对于需要处理多种数据源的用户,ImportExcel提供了强大的批量导出能力。无论是系统进程信息、服务状态监控、文件列表整理还是网络API数据获取,都可以一次性导出到不同的Excel工作表中。

批量数据导出演示

这个功能特别适合需要定期生成报表的系统管理员和数据分析师。通过自动化脚本,您可以设置定时任务,实现每日、每周或每月的自动化报表生成,大大提升工作效率。

专业级图表生成能力

无需打开Excel界面,直接在PowerShell中生成专业级图表是ImportExcel的又一亮点。支持从简单的折线图到复杂的三角函数图表,满足各种数据可视化需求。

销售数据图表与透视表结合

在商业应用场景中,ImportExcel能够快速生成销售数据透视表和可视化图表。这个功能特别适合销售团队进行区域业绩分析和市场趋势预测,帮助决策者直观了解业务状况。

实际应用场景案例分享

系统监控与性能报表

使用Get-ProcessGet-Service命令结合ImportExcel,可以创建实时的系统资源监控报表。系统管理员可以定期收集服务器性能数据,自动生成详细的性能分析报告。

业务数据分析与报告

通过数据透视表和图表功能,销售团队可以快速分析区域销售表现,制定精准的市场策略。财务部门可以使用ImportExcel处理财务报表,进行预算分析和成本控制。

自动化数据清洗与转换

开发人员可以利用ImportExcel进行数据预处理,将不同格式的数据源转换为统一的Excel格式,为后续的数据分析和机器学习提供标准化的输入数据。

快速入门指南:三步开始使用

第一步:安装ImportExcel模块

安装ImportExcel模块非常简单,只需在PowerShell中运行以下命令:

Install-Module -Name ImportExcel

如果您希望从源代码安装,可以使用以下命令克隆仓库:

git clone https://gitcode.com/gh_mirrors/im/ImportExcel

第二步:基本数据导入导出

导入Excel文件的基本命令:

$data = Import-Excel -Path "data.xlsx"

导出数据到Excel文件:

$data | Export-Excel -Path "output.xlsx" -Show

第三步:创建简单图表

生成基本的柱状图:

$data | Export-Excel -Path "chart.xlsx" -IncludePivotChart -ChartType ColumnClustered

进阶使用技巧与最佳实践

条件格式设置技巧

ImportExcel支持丰富的条件格式功能,包括数据条、图标集和色阶等。合理使用条件格式可以让您的报表更加专业和易读。

数据验证规则配置

为Excel单元格添加数据验证规则,确保数据输入的准确性和一致性。这对于需要多人协作的数据录入工作特别重要。

性能优化建议

  • 对于大数据集,建议使用分块处理技术
  • 合理利用缓存机制提升处理速度
  • 根据数据量调整内存分配策略
  • 避免不必要的格式设置,专注于数据本身

常见问题解答

Q: ImportExcel模块需要安装Microsoft Excel吗?A: 完全不需要!这是模块最大的优势之一。ImportExcel使用纯.NET库处理Excel文件,无需任何Microsoft Office组件。

Q: 支持哪些Excel文件格式?A: 主要支持.xlsx格式(Excel 2007及以上版本),这是现代Excel的标准格式。

Q: 是否支持加密的Excel文件?A: 是的,ImportExcel支持密码保护的Excel文件读写操作。

Q: 处理大型Excel文件时性能如何?A: ImportExcel针对性能进行了优化,可以高效处理包含数万行数据的大型文件。对于超大型数据集,建议使用分页处理技术。

Q: 是否支持图表和数据透视表的自定义?A: 是的,ImportExcel提供了丰富的参数选项,允许您自定义图表类型、数据透视表布局和各种格式设置。

总结:让数据处理变得更简单高效

PowerShell ImportExcel模块为数据处理工作带来了革命性的改变。它不仅功能强大、性能优异,更重要的是完全免费开源!无论您是初学者还是专业人士,都能从中获得巨大的价值。

通过本文的介绍,您已经了解了ImportExcel模块的核心功能、安装方法、使用技巧和实际应用场景。现在就开始您的Excel数据处理之旅吧!让ImportExcel模块成为您工作中不可或缺的得力助手,释放数据处理的真正潜力。

记住,强大的数据处理能力不应该被昂贵的软件许可所限制。ImportExcel证明了开源工具同样可以提供企业级的数据处理解决方案。开始探索这个神奇的工具,发现数据处理的新可能!

【免费下载链接】ImportExcelPowerShell module to import/export Excel spreadsheets, without Excel项目地址: https://gitcode.com/gh_mirrors/im/ImportExcel

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/29 19:48:46

3D高斯泼溅技术解析与F4Splat创新应用

1. 3D高斯泼溅技术基础解析3D高斯泼溅(3D Gaussian Splatting)是近年来计算机视觉领域突破性的显式3D场景表示方法。与传统的隐式神经辐射场(NeRF)不同,它采用显式的高斯基元集合来表征场景,每个基元包含位…

作者头像 李华
网站建设 2026/4/29 19:48:40

Cursor Pro激活器完全指南:轻松实现AI编程助手无限试用

Cursor Pro激活器完全指南:轻松实现AI编程助手无限试用 【免费下载链接】cursor-free-vip [Support 0.45](Multi Language 多语言)自动注册 Cursor Ai ,自动重置机器ID , 免费升级使用Pro 功能: Youve reached your tr…

作者头像 李华
网站建设 2026/4/29 19:46:44

深耕行业“Know-How”,填补工程短板

作者:毛烁“对于大多数初创企业来说,挑战并不是如何把产品做出来,而是如何把产品卖掉。” MathWorks公司MATLAB产品家族市场总监David Rich一语道破了初创科技企业的核心痛点。MathWorks公司MATLAB产品家族市场总监David Rich针对这一点&…

作者头像 李华
网站建设 2026/4/29 19:45:31

AI模型统一管理平台:架构设计与工程实践指南

1. 项目概述与核心价值最近在折腾AI应用开发的朋友,估计都绕不开一个头疼的问题:模型管理。当你手头有几个不同的开源大模型,比如Llama、ChatGLM、Qwen,再加上一堆五花八门的API服务,比如OpenAI、DeepSeek、智谱&#…

作者头像 李华